- Whale watching from P'town, ferry out of Harwich to Nantucket and from Hyannis to Martha's Vineyard (in season), seal cruises from Outermost Harbor in Chatham, Orleans Redbirds games at Eldredge Park - a short walk from the cottage, bike to Crystal Lake, Rock Harbor for fishing charters and great sunsets, local fairs and art shows, flea market at Wellfleet Cinema, Orleans Farmers' Market for organic vegetables every Saturday morning (get there early!)
